본문 바로가기

2018/042

크롬 inspected target crashed inspected target crashed 오류가 발생하였다. 정확히는 크롬이 아니라 크로미움에서 발생한 오류였다. 평소에는 엑셀을 잘 다운받는데, 엑셀의 데이터가 많아지면 오류가 생겼다. 엑셀을 내려받을 때, a태그의 href 속성에 base64로 만들어서 내려받았는데, 그 길이가 긴 경우 생기는 문제였다. 크로미움의 버그로 알려졌다고 한다. 크로미움 버그(긴 url인 경우 죽어버리는 현상) : https://bugs.chromium.org/p/chromium/issues/detail?id=69227 결론은 base64 사용시 클라이언트 브라우저의 한계였다. base64를 다른 형식으로 변환해야했고, 나의 경우에는 base64를 blob으로 변경했다. 해결책 : Blob과 URL.createObjec.. 2018. 4. 17.
SSL/TLS 보안 채널에 대한 트러스트 관계를 설정할 수 없습니다. An unhandled exception occurred: System.Net.WebException: 기본 연결이 닫혔습니다. SSL/TLS 보안 채널에 대한 트러스트 관계를 설정할 수 없습니다. ---> System.Security.Authentication.AuthenticationException: 유효성 검사 절차에 따르면 원격 인증서가 잘못되었습니다. 해당 에러는 C#에서 서버의 인증서를 확인할 때 잘못된 경우에 발생한다. 일반적으로 서버측 SSL인증서 문제다. 하지만, 우리의 경우는 좀 특이했다. 소수의 사용자들에게서 문제가 생긴 것이다. 모두의 문제라면 서버측 문제이지만, 소수의 사용자라서 그들의 컴퓨터를 확인해야 했다. 우리는 인증서 발급을 행자부로부터 받는다. GPKI인증서의 신뢰도에 .. 2018. 4. 6.